Summer Time

Ever blossom summer bright
Warm evenings sheer delight 
Wondrous beaches sand in your toes 
Take a swim cool off your woes 
Outdoors dreaming, cooking up right 
Party time barbecue invite 
Grow now grow to your gardens flight 
Watch your tomato vines ripe 
Ever blossom summer bright 
Wonderful rains dark skies such a fright 
Cooling off the hot tar tonight 
Pretty songbirds singing their song 
Tip your hat to the early morn 
Vacation trip upon the ships memories to be born 
Baseball season in full peak 
Go to a game take a seat 
Ever blossom summer bright 
Lie on your chair and gaze at the moonlight
